A short while back I posted that I had a modified set of Halogen headlight assemblies. Basically I seperated the assemblies and painted the non reflective surface satin black. I mainly did this as a trial to see how I would like it on a HID set. I finally got around to finishing the project this weekend and I now have them installed.....I really like the look and will likely do the same treatment to my HID set. I simply removed all the attachment brackets and heated the assembly in the oven (250 for 15mins) Once warm the glue was softened allowing me to remove the lense. Once apart I just removed the outer chrome trim ring, scuffed, cleaned and painted. Followed by reassembly and installation for pics!!! When I do the HID assemblies I'll paint everything except for the silver ring around the projector
